South Of India Profile

South Of India is a 5 year old chestnut gelding. South Of India is trained by Dominic Sutton, at Flemington and owned by Tullimbar Pty Ltd Syndicate (Mgr: R M McConville).

South Of India’s last race event was at 21/02/2026 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

South Of India Racing Form

Career form is 7 wins, seconds, 1 thirds from 21 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$436,275.

With a 33% Win Percentage and 38% Place Percentage. South Of India's last race event was at Rosehill.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-8-5-1-5.
